csabareti Posted April 21, 2015 Share Posted April 21, 2015 Hi, I bought an AMPLIFI TT yesterday. When I first connected my iphone 5s to it via bluetooth, it worked just fine, at least I didn't notice that anything was slow. Then I upgraded AMPLIFI TT to the latest firmware. I'm not sure if it was only after that, or before too, but now as I connect my phone and click on AMPLIFI TT in the app to see the presets, it takes a lot of time to download all the presets from the unit. First I only see some 4-8 Presets, then after a few seconds another 4 and all together it takes a lot of time (a minute or two) to see all the presets. Is there something wrong here, or is it just as it works normally? Isn't there a way to switch off this constant downloading each time I start the app? Thanks for your help! Triryche Posted April 21, 2015 Share Posted April 21, 2015 There's really no way to stop the synch process other than breaking the Bluetooth connection.. The 100 presets reside in the hardware, so when ever the app connects to the AMPLIFi it automatically starts the synch. Quote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
csabareti Posted April 21, 2015 Author Share Posted April 21, 2015 Maybe an idea could be for further releases that the app would only sync at startup, and not each time it gets back focus from another app (while running in background). Or, the app could download only the time stamps of the last preset changes (which could go really fast) and would only download those presets that are more recent in the unit than in the memory of the app. All-in-all it would be easy to reach where the user doesn't have to wait for the sync.
